  JOB SUMMARY

  The Branch Logistics Supervisor performs, plans, and coordinates the daily activity of all Logistics personnel and functions.

  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  Manages the Logistics department for the branch to ensure timely and accurate delivery of products.

  Ensures staff compliance with all applicable regulatory requirements including, but not limited to, providing documents for the driver qualification file and abiding by hours of service, daily log, hazardous materials (placarding, training and shipping papers), daily vehicle inspections and reports, and maintenance regulations.

  Schedules Delivery employees on a daily and on-call basis.

  Completes daily route preparation.

  Assigns additional routes as patient and referral requests are received. May occasionally perform Delivery employee's responsibilities if there is a temporary shortage of delivery employees.

  Performs special projects such as researching methods to improve productivity and cut costs in the branch distribution function.

  May work with Corporate Purchasing on the ordering of special equipment and new products.

  Troubleshoots problems regarding the shortages of Delivery employee staff, routes, and the loading of equipment.

  Monitors and/or maintains close contact with Delivery employees throughout day to ensure routes are completed in a timely and accurate manner.

  Ensures Logistics employees load trucks properly and efficiently.

  Assists Logistics employees with special orders and equipment. May assist Logistics employees with the loading of trucks when necessary.

  Maintains daily vehicle maintenance logs and documentation of incident reports.

  Maintains proper levels of stock in warehouse to ensure maximum profitability.

  Performs minor equipment repair and maintenance as required. Maintains files on all equipment.

  Responds to telephone calls from patients, referral sources, vendors and Delivery employees regarding equipment orders, patient problems and delivery employee incidents.

  May need to perform on-call duties as needed.

  May manage multiple branch locations as needed.

  Performs other duties as required.

  SUPERVISORY RESPONSIBILITIES

  Typically supervises a team of primarily nonexempt employees.

  Responsible for hiring, coaching, and performance management of subordinate staff.

  Ensures that all direct reports and their subordinates are maintaining acceptable performance levels.

  Conducts Staff meetings regularly to review new business requirements.
